Horseshoe Falls, A Historical Lampasas Gem! Also known as Gunderland Park, a sprawling 378-ac high-fenced ranch. This is a very rare opportunity to own both sides of Sulphur Creek, as it flows year-round through the ranch. Be transformed to another world with the abundance of native tree cover, wildlife, and the sounds of living water. Adored by many, locals can recall fond childhood memories of fishing and camping here. An original merry-go-round and hand-built rock BBQ pits, benches, and tables still remain intact. An upper pasture blooms with sunflowers, attracting quail hunting enthusiasts. Most recently, this one-of-a-kind property is being used as an exotic ranch, serving guests with exclusive hunts and catered private events. The ranch's centerpiece is a spacious 2,500+ sq ft 1.5-story primary home with 4 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, and two living areas, offering breathtaking views and sounds of the ever-flowing Sulphur Creek dam. This site holds important significance as Captain J.F. Brannon of the Ninth Infantry commissioned 193 men to build the Lampasas State Park & Dam in June 1933. Beyond the main residence, discover a 2400 sq ft., climate-controlled main hall overlooking the live water of Sulphur Creek, equipped with restrooms and a rustic rock fireplace upon entry. Perfect for weddings, private or corporate events, or private family get-togethers. Capable of seating up to 150 people comfortably around dining tables, with additional seating outside on the rock patio. Additionally, there are six fully restored and uniquely decorated cabins. All with unique themed decor with names such as: The Ranger Station, Bass Bungalow, Bird's Nest, Tee Pee, La Cabana & of course, the JAIL. Most cabins sleep 2-6 guests with full bathrooms. A Lodge, aka The Horn Room is equipped with a full kitchen for serving a larger party of guests at once. Enjoy a game of pool or darts in the game room.
